EASY PRALINE SAUCE FOR ICE CREAM- DAD'S RECIPE

Here is another one of my Dad's ice cream sauces. This praline sauce is delicious and not hard to make at all. Just a wonderful dessert for a hot summer day! Mom loved this on butter pecan ice cream. One of her most favorites ever. Picture of pecans is clip art.

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 4

1/3 c water
1/3 c brown sugar, firmly packed
1 c light corn syrup
1 c chopped pecans

Steps:

  • 1. Bring water to a boil in a medium saucepan. When boiling add remaining ingredients and stir as it returns to a boil. When it reaches a full boil remove from heat, pour into a container, and refrigerate. Mixture will thicken as it cools.
  • 2. Serve over ice cream. Add whipped topping and a cherry if desired.
